Can You Mix and Match Outdoor Furniture?

Mixing and matching outdoor furniture can be a great way to liven up your patio or backyard. This approach allows you to create a unique look that reflects your personal style.

Plus, it can also save you money by buying pieces from different collections instead of one complete set.

When mixing and matching outdoor furniture, there are some important tips to keep in mind. First, make sure the pieces you choose are made of quality materials that will withstand the elements.

Second, consider the size and shape of each piece in relation to the space you have available. Third, think about how each piece would work together for comfort and usability. Finally, choose colors and patterns that complement each other.

Choosing Pieces

When selecting pieces for your outdoor space, consider the type of activities you plan on doing there. If you’re planning on entertaining guests frequently, look for items such as chairs, tables and benches that provide comfortable seating for everyone. If you plan on using the area for relaxing alone or with family, opt for items like chaise lounges or hammocks.

Mixing Materials

When combining different materials, such as metal and wood, make sure to use complementary colors so the overall look is balanced and harmonious. For example, if one piece is made of black metal and another is made of teak wood in a natural finish, opt for cushions or pillows in a neutral shade such as beige so they don’t clash with either material.

Accessorizing

Once you’ve selected your furniture pieces, accessorizing can add a touch of personality to the space. Throw pillows with vibrant colors or interesting patterns can bring life to an otherwise boring area.

Outdoor rugs are also great for creating an inviting atmosphere while also protecting your deck or patio from scratches caused by furniture legs.
